I can send a file to a friend of mine from LearnLink. Is there a system problem?

0

Probably not. Since it is possible to send email within LearnLink that never leaves the LearnLink system, some file types are not allowed to be emailed or sent to prevent viruses or Trojans from replicating in the system or being sent out. Email that is sent out of LearnLink is scanned for viruses by the security team, but email that doesn’t leave LearnLink may have no virus detection/protection at all. Since the email stays within LearnLink, your own virus protection (Symantec) may not detect the virus. Also, file attachments have to be encoded to be sent out. This increases the size of the file and it may take your account over your disk space limit (if you are over limit, you cannot send emails out).
